cut: improve detection of invalid ranges
Commit 0068ce2fa (cut: add toybox-compatible options -O OUTSEP, -D, -F LIST) added detection of reversed ranges. Further improvements are possible. - The test for reversed ranges compared the start after it had been decremented with the end before decrement. It thus missed ranges of the form 2-1. - Zero isn't a valid start value for a range. (Nor is it a valid end value, but that's caught by the test for a reversed range.) - The code if (!*ltok) e = INT_MAX; duplicates a check that's already been made. - Display the actual range in the error message to make it easier to find which range was at fault. function old new delta .rodata 100273 100287 +14 cut_main 1239 1237 -2 ------------------------------------------------------------------------------ (add/remove: 0/0 grow/shrink: 1/1 up/down: 14/-2) Total: 12 bytes Signed-off-by: Ron Yorston <rmy@pobox.com> Signed-off-by: Denys Vlasenko <vda.linux@googlemail.com>
